首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

API.AI上意图和实体的JSON文件格式

API.AI(现在更名为Dialogflow)是一款由谷歌开发的自然语言处理平台,用于构建智能对话代理。在API.AI上,意图(Intent)和实体(Entity)是两个重要的概念。

意图(Intent)是指用户在进行对话时的意图或目的。它可以理解为用户想要实现的某种操作或回答的问题。在API.AI中,意图可以通过训练模型来识别用户的意图,并根据意图执行相应的操作或提供相应的回答。

实体(Entity)是指在对话中具有特定意义的关键词或短语。它可以理解为对话中需要从用户的输入中提取的重要信息。在API.AI中,实体可以用来识别用户提供的关键信息,并将其作为参数传递给后端服务进行处理。

JSON文件格式是一种轻量级的数据交换格式,常用于存储和传输结构化数据。在API.AI中,意图和实体的定义可以通过JSON文件进行描述和配置。

意图的JSON文件格式通常包含以下字段:

  • "name":意图的名称。
  • "auto":指定是否自动分配用户输入到该意图。
  • "contexts":指定与该意图相关的上下文。
  • "responses":指定对该意图的回答或操作。
  • "userSays":指定用户可能的输入样本。

实体的JSON文件格式通常包含以下字段:

  • "name":实体的名称。
  • "isEnum":指定实体是否为枚举类型。
  • "automatedExpansion":指定是否自动扩展实体。
  • "entries":指定实体的值和同义词。

API.AI提供了丰富的功能和应用场景,包括但不限于:

  • 聊天机器人:通过定义意图和实体,可以构建智能对话代理,实现自然语言交互。
  • 语音助手:结合语音识别和自然语言处理,实现语音指令的理解和执行。
  • 智能客服:通过对用户问题的意图识别,自动回答常见问题或转接到人工客服。
  • 语义分析:通过对用户输入的意图和实体进行分析,提取关键信息,用于后续的业务处理。

腾讯云提供了类似的自然语言处理服务,可以与API.AI相媲美。您可以了解腾讯云的自然语言处理服务NLP,它提供了意图识别、实体识别、情感分析等功能,适用于各种语义分析场景。详情请参考腾讯云NLP产品介绍:https://cloud.tencent.com/product/nlp

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

一份在移动应用程序项目中使用机器学习的指南

机器学习是人工智能的核心,旨在创建一个解决类似问题的通用方法。机器学习已经被整合到我们经常在日常生活中使用应用中,比如iPhone的Siri。本文是一个包含了如何在移动应用中使用机器学习的指南。 机器学习的工作原理 机器学习是基于人工神经网络的实现,人工神经网络在我们日常生活中的APP(比方说语音助手)和系统软件中都被广泛使用。它们可以进行诊断测试、探索生物学与合成材料。而人工神经网络相当于人类的神经元和中枢神经系统。这可能有点难以理解,所以我们来看看人脑是如何进行记忆和识别的。 与计算机不同,人脑更加强大

06

AI 技术讲座精选:如何利用 Python 读取数据科学中常见几种文件?

前 言 如果你是数据行业的一份子,那么你肯定会知道和不同的数据类型打交道是件多么麻烦的事。不同数据格式、不同压缩算法、不同系统下的不同解析方法——很快就会让你感到抓狂!噢!我还没提那些非结构化数据和半结构化数据呢。 对于所有数据科学家和数据工程师来说,和不同的格式打交道都乏味透顶!但现实情况是,人们很少能得到整齐的列表数据。因此,熟悉不同的文件格式、了解处理它们时会遇到的困难以及处理某类数据时的最佳/最高效的方法,对于任何一个数据科学家(或者数据工程师)而言都必不可少。 在本篇文章中,你会了解到数据科学家

04

基于avconv转码工具的微信小程序语音识别功能实现~

“ 最近在做基于微信小程序【垃圾分类引导指南】的语音识别功能模块时,遇到了一个比较头疼得事情,由于腾讯AI开放平台的接口只支持PCM、WAV、AMR和SILK四种音频格式,而微信小程序录音的音频文件是mp3格式的(此处就是踩得第一大坑了,刚开始看到开发文档是的时候心里还暗喜了一波,因为微信小程序录音文件就可以设置为SILK格式,这样岂不是可以不费吹灰之力就搞定了想想有点头疼的语音识别啦~然而我们终究还是太年轻~折腾了半天,在真机测试的时候发现木有半点反应,调试发现没有生成录音文件,真的是丈二和尚摸不着头脑的赶脚,最后查了一番资料才知道微信小程序在真机上只能设置成acc和mp3格式的),那么这里就不得不进行音频格式转化了。”

01
领券